When do campsites usually open up at Pala'au State Park?
Whenever someone cancels. Most reservation systems refund less the closer you get to arrival, so cancellations cluster in the days before a stay — but the openings themselves are unpredictable, which is exactly why watching for them beats refreshing the page.
